Lepin Science Building Modernization TRU
The modernization project at Thompson Rivers University’s Lepin Science Building was a comprehensive undertaking encompassing many renovations and upgrades. The project began with significant demolition work, paving the way for a series of extensive improvements across various disciplines.
Key aspects of the renovation included substantial electrical and mechanical upgrades, enhancing the building’s functionality and energy efficiency. Architectural millwork was a focal point, adding aesthetic value and sophistication to the interior spaces. The project also involved the installation of new drywall, flooring, and wood ceilings, contributing to the overall modern look and feel of the building.
Additionally, the project included painting and other finishing works, ensuring that every detail of the building’s interior was refreshed and revitalized. This modernization effort not only improved the aesthetics and utility of the Lepin Science Building but also ensured that it met the evolving educational needs of Thompson Rivers University.
